So, yesterday, on Day 2 of mid-sem break, Kak Ayn so impromptu sangat tiba-tiba suggest pegi apple-picking. And I'm like, why not right? Another part of Canberra to be explored! So at around 3pm like that me, Kak Ayn n Zack gerak to Pialligo. Google dalam internet the place tu namanya Pialligo la kan. Tapi sebenarnya ada banyak orchards to choose from. So we just gamble and drive towards Pialligo; wherever that is (actually Pialligo tu near to Canberra Airport jaa, hehe).
So, the moment masuk Beltana Road tu, alongside the road kiri kanan semua orchards and nurseries. So boleh pilih lah which farm you'd like to pick apples from kan. Tapi I guess since we pegi ni bulan April and dah masuk Autumn kat Aussie ni, hence tak banyak apples lagi dah available untuk picking. Among the first few orchards yang we passed by tu, mostly dah tutup. Drive dalam sikit, terjumpa la Tanbella's Orchard ni and we terus masuk. Time we all sampai tu pun, ada lebih kurang sejam lagi nak tutup orchard tu.
Masuk-masuk ja, memang friendly one of the lady farmers yang jaga the orchard situ. So before masuk, diorang akan give us pamphlet la kan for us to navigate in the farm nanti and also satu baldi untuk simpan apples yang we kutip.
Above: Me tengah pegang pamphlet and Kak Ayn tengah pegang baldi.
Tapi yeah, since dah Autumn ni, cuma a small portion ja of the orchard tu yang we can explore.Yang lain the apple trees either takda buah anymore or baru nak tumbuh apples nya.
So waktu tengah picking tu, boleh petik any apples you like and taste them on the spot la. That one free of charge. So kalau larat, makan la seberapa banyak pun. Nanti apples yang dah dikutip in our baldi tadi tu, itu ja yang diorang akan charge. Hehe.
The types yang we all sempat merasa during dalam Tanbella tu are Red Delicious, Jonathan, Golden Delicious and Mixed Heritage. But in my opinion, the best among all is Golden Delicious.
